WebJun 7, 2024 · Organs of human hearing are located on either side of the head. Essential for hearing and balance, each ear has an intricate structure of bones, nerves, and muscles. The ears can be affected by bacterial infections, viral infections, hearing loss, tinnitus (ringing in the ears), Meniere’s disease, and more. 1. WebHuman ear. The ear is divided into three anatomical regions: the external ear, the middle ear, and the internal ear (Figure 2).
